This case study details Telus's implementation of Open RAN technology in response to a Canadian government mandate to remove Huawei solutions from service provider networks by 2027. Telus aims to be the first in North America to adopt a fully O-RAN-compliant 5G network, with deployment ambitions set for 2024. The document outlines the challenges faced by Telus, including the integration of Open RAN with existing systems, adherence to industry standards, and the transition from a traditional deployment model to a multi-vendor O-RAN-based approach. It also describes the partnership with Wind River and Samsung to deploy the Wind River Studio solution, which includes various integrated components. The results of this deployment highlight benefits such as reduced operational costs, improved network performance, and compliance with government regulations. The case study emphasizes Telus's commitment to innovation and the advantages of adopting a disaggregated network architecture.
